Demora para sair da Suspensão [RESOLVIDO]

1. Demora para sair da Suspensão [RESOLVIDO]

Rafael Fassi Lobão
rflobao

(usa Debian)

Enviado em 14/02/2011 - 14:24h

Oi pessoal!

Tenho um note Positivo com processador core2 Duo, 3GB de Ram e placa de vídeo Sis 671 (sei q essa placa n é muito boa para linux, mas meu problema é $$$) ;)
Estou usando o Debian 6 squeeze.

O único problema que tenho com ele é a demora para sair do modo de suspensão.
Quando dou o comando para suspender ele entra quase que instantaneamente no modo de suspensão, mas para sair demora 36s. Isso é quase o tempo que ele demora pra ser restaurado de uma hibernação (42s).

Pensei que o problema poderia ser o driver de vídeo, pois nos 36s que contei ele não ativa o monitor. Mas mesmo desabilitando o driver de vídeo no xorg o problema continuou. Tentei também desabilitar a rede...

Outra possibilidade pra mim seria o próprio hardware, mas como tenho um dual boot com Win (preciso dele pra rodar um programa específico do meu trabalho que se comunica por USB. Ele não funciona no wine e nem na VM). Mas continuando... No Win ele volta rapidamente do modo de espera. Claro que isso não excluí a possibilidade de hardware.

Acredito que o problema possa estar em algum serviço que demora a iniciar, mas realmente não sei :(

Alguém ja teve algum problema parecido?

Como sou meio “Jegão” em linux, gostaria de saber:
Existe algum arquivo log que registre a inicialização dos serviços com os horários ou tempos?
Se eu me aventurar a recompilar o kernel (isso me da medo, rs) e desativar alguns módulos desnecessários, será que resolveria?

Desculpem se falei alguma besteira, é q estou começando no linux agora :)



  


2. MELHOR RESPOSTA

Ednilton Santos de Oliveira
ednilton_so

(usa KUbuntu)

Enviado em 14/02/2011 - 17:00h

todo mundo sabe que é uma porcaria com o Linux. Eles não fornecem driver pra Linux e nem documentação para a comunidade desenvolver drivers. Portanto, é um milagre que o seu sistema esteja suspendendo sem travar.

Eu tinha um Positivo com o chipset VIA e até hoje não suspende, nem com a versão mais nova do Ubuntu. Já o meu CCE atual suspende uma beleza no Ubuntu 10.10, mas com kernel compilado 2.6.37 e muitos módulos removidos. Com o kernel padrão desse Ubuntu, ele travava aleatoriamente na suspensão. No entanto, é chipset Intel e custou o mesmo preço que teria sido um com chipset VIA ou SiS, ou até mais barato que um Positivo com chipset SiS.

Talvez o melhor a fazer mesmo seja compilar o kernel mais atual e remover alguns módulos que você tem certeza que são desnecessários para o sistema. Se for só compilar o kernel genérico talvez funcione também e não tem segredo. Mas realmente, acho que o seu problema é o chipset e a probabilidade de uma compilação resolver é muito pequena.

Boa sorte.

3. Re: Demora para sair da Suspensão [RESOLVIDO]

Rafael Fassi Lobão
rflobao

(usa Debian)

Enviado em 14/02/2011 - 16:34h

Em outro grupo de discussão, me passaram 2 comandos que utilizei para analisar o problema: dmesg e syslog.

O syslog não ajudou muito, veja o resultado:

>====== Dei o comando para entrar em modo de espera ás 14:00:00

Feb 14 14:00:02 noterafa anacron[3885]: Anacron 2.3 started on 2011-02-14
Feb 14 14:00:02 noterafa anacron[3885]: Normal exit (0 jobs run)
Feb 14 14:00:02 noterafa NetworkManager[1202]: <info> sleep requested (sleeping: no enabled: no)
Feb 14 14:00:02 noterafa NetworkManager[1202]: <info> sleeping or disabling...

>====== Entrou em modo de espera ás 14:00:02


>====== Dei o comando para sair do modo de espera ás 14:02:00


>====== O kernel só começou a gerar log ás 14:02:35 como é mostrado abaixo

Feb 14 14:02:35 noterafa kernel: [ 1340.260374] PM: Syncing filesystems ... done.
Feb 14 14:02:35 noterafa kernel: [ 1340.285179] PM: Preparing system for mem sleep
.
.
.

>====== O monitor ativou ás 14:02:38

.
.
.
Feb 14 14:02:39 noterafa NetworkManager[1202]: <info> sleeping or disabling...
Feb 14 14:02:39 noterafa anacron[4182]: Anacron 2.3 started on 2011-02-14
Feb 14 14:02:39 noterafa anacron[4182]: Normal exit (0 jobs run)

Isso significa que durante o tempo que levou pra sair do modo de suspensão, não foi gerado logue.


Mas o dmesg quebrou meu galho!

[ 2752.388157] jmb38x_ms 0000:03:00.3: setting latency timer to 64
[ 2752.520057] sd 2:0:0:0: [sda] Starting disk
[ 2783.000044] ata3: lost interrupt (Status 0x50)
[ 2783.000079] sd 2:0:0:0: [sda] START_STOP FAILED
[ 2783.000082] sd 2:0:0:0: [sda] Result: hostbyte=DID_OK driverbyte=DRIVER_TIMEO

Em 2752 mandou ativar o disco sda e o próximo registro só ocorreu em 2783.
Então levou 2783-2752 = 31s para ativar o disco sda.

Pelo menos agora ja sei que a demora é para ativar o disco. Só falta saber como resolver :P


4. Re: Demora para sair da Suspensão [RESOLVIDO]

Daniel Vieceli
DanielVieceli755

(usa Debian)

Enviado em 14/02/2011 - 16:39h

Opa, tenho um Acer Ferrari One , demora quase 35 segundos para sair do modo, acho que é normal . Valeu






Patrocínio

Site hospedado pelo provedor RedeHost.
Linux banner

Destaques

Artigos

Dicas

Tópicos

Top 10 do mês

Scripts